What are common Volkswagen repair issues for cars driven on Kurten's rural and farm-to-market roads?

The rough, chip-seal surfaces common on local rural roads can lead to premature wear on suspension components like control arms and bushings, as well as tire damage. Volkswagen models, especially those with low-profile tires, are susceptible to these issues, making regular suspension inspections important for Kurten-area drivers.

How does the Central Texas heat impact my Volkswagen, and what service should I prioritize?

The prolonged summer heat can stress cooling systems and lead to battery failure. It is crucial to have your Volkswagen's coolant system, including the water pump and thermostat (known issues on some VW models), checked regularly to prevent overheating, especially before the intense Texas summer.

When should I seek a specialist versus a general mechanic for my VW repair in the Bryan/Kurten area?

Always seek a specialist for complex electrical issues, DSG transmission service, or turbocharger repairs, as these systems require specific tools and knowledge. For general maintenance like oil changes, a reputable local mechanic may suffice, but ensure they use VW-specific fluids and filters.
